Golden Ninja Warrior is a curious piece from '87 that really leans into its action roots. You’ve got this rivalry between the Golden and Red Ninja Warriors that serves as the backbone of the story, but honestly, it's the pacing that caught my eye. It lurches from one violent encounter to another, which keeps the adrenaline pumping despite some awkward transitions. The lack of a revealed Golden Ninja Statue is kind of intriguing; it adds a layer of mystery that’s not quite fulfilled. The Hong Kong setting is gritty, with a criminal organization that feels reminiscent of exploitation films from that era. The practical effects are pretty wild, and while the performances can be hit or miss, there’s a raw energy that’s hard to ignore. It’s a true oddity, worth watching just for the vibe.
